El efecto estimulador del glp-1 sobre el transprote de la hexosa parece depender, en gran medida, de una activaci\u00f3n de la pi3k\/pkb, posiblemente de la pp-1 y, esencialmente, de la p70s6k y p42\/44 mapks y el incremento en la actividad gluc\u00f3geno sintasa a inducido por glp-1 est\u00e1 mediado por un aumento en la de pi3k\/pkb, p42\/44 mapks y, parcialmente, pkc; pero a diferencia con la insulina, en esta acci\u00f3n del p\u00e9ptido no parece intervenir la p70s6k, ni ninguna de las dos prote\u00ednas fosfatasas, pp-1 y pp-2a.<\/p>\n<p>&nbsp;<\/p>\n<h3>Datos acad\u00e9micos de la
